Paramount+ has announced that the McLusky family will be back for a second season ofMayor of Kingstown. Season 2 of theTaylor Sheridan-helmed crime drama will continue to explore the prison business in the town of Kingstown, where the corrupt and unequal system is the only thing keeping the local economy turning.
Mayor of Kingstownfollows a family deeply involved with maintaining the order in a small town in Michigan by acting as power brokers between the inmates of a prison and the people who make money by prolonging incarceration. The series explores how the system is more than often rigged against certain social groups and that justice is not always the goal of the U.S. prison system.

StarringJeremy Renner,Dianne Wiest,Kyle Chandler, andTaylor Handleyas theMcLusky family,Mayor of Kingstownbecame Paramount+’s biggest premiere to datesince the rebranding of the streaming service (formerly CBS All Access). Due to its simulcast premiere on November 14,Mayor of Kingstownalso became the biggest premiere on cable television since 2018’sYellowstone, which was also co-created by Sheridan. WhileYellowstonestill holds the position of most-watched original series on Paramount+,Mayor of Kingstownhas already reached second place. So, a renewal makes a lot of sense for the streaming platform.

The first season ofMayor of Kingstownalso starredHugh Dillon,Pha’rez Lass,Tobi Bamtefa,Emma Laird, andDerek Webster. The series was created by Sheridan and Dillon, with the duo also serving as executive producers together withAntoine Fuqua,David C. Glasser,Ron Burkle,Bob Yari, andMichael Friedman.
Commenting on the renewal, Fuqua said he’s “thrilled” to continue working for Season 2, since “Mayor of Kingstownis such an important project that offers a comprehensive look into the brutal prison system.” Glasser also underlined that it’s wonderful news that “shows likeMayor of Kingstown– original stories with layered characters and important themes – are able to thrive on Paramount+.”
Tanya Giles, Chief Programming Officer of ViacomCBS Streaming, also said:
“WithMayor of Kingstown, Taylor Sheridan and Hugh Dillon offer a nuanced portrayal of the United States’ harsh prison system. The stellar crew and cast, including Jeremy Renner and Dianne Wiest, delivered a thought-provoking, intense drama that kept audiences captivated and yearning for more. We are thrilled to be the home of the expanding Taylor Sheridan Universe and we look forward to bringing fans back to Kingstown next season.”
The first season ofMayor of Kingstownis available to binge exclusively on Paramount+. There’s still no release window for Season 2.
